i have G={[1 0 1;1 0 0;0 0 1;1 1 1] and out put should be I={[1 0;1 0; 0 0;1 1]} how can i get
using for loop

If you do not have to use a for loop you can just do:
I = G(:, 1:2)
but if you have to use a for loop:
for ii = 1:size(G, 1)
I(ii, 1:2) = G(ii, 1:2);
end

Assume the element in I is the first two columns of the element in G.
G=[1 0 1;1 0 0;0 0 1;1 1 1];
[M,N]=size(G);
I=zeros(M,2);
for k=1:size(G,1)
I(k,:)=G(k,1:2);
end
Without for-loop, you can do.
I=G(:,1:2)
